Union Square Academy for Health Sciences is dedicated to creating a college going culture for all students. Through a partnership with CollegeBound Initiative (CBI), Union Square Academy provides a full-time Director of College Counseling to assist students with their college application process. This includes essay writing, selecting colleges, one-on-one counseling, college trips, college fairs, College Admissions Counselors presentations, collecting letters of recommendation, applying to college, completing the Free Application for Federal Student Aid, and reviewing all financial aid award letters to see which colleges are offering the best opportunities for students. The class of 2016 was the first graduating class of Union Square Academy. This class not only received over $1,000,000.00 in financial aid, scholarship, and grants, but 95% of graduating seniors matriculated into college.
